In 1980, life expectancy was 42.9 years in Nigeria at the time when sub-Saharan Africa and the world total was 46.3 and 60.7 years, respectively. How-ever, by 1990, Nigeria had a better percentage increase of 6.8% in life expectancy compared with sub-Saharan Africa (6.3%) and the world total (5.5%). The marginal
